Position Summary Reporting to the Vice President, Corporate Finance, the Finance Coordinator provides high-level organizational support to the Finance function as well as administrative support to the SVP, Finance & CFO, the VP, Corporate Finance, and the VP, Business Transformation enabling these senior leaders to focus on strategic priorities and overall financial leadership of the organization. This role is responsible for supporting financial and executive communications, compiling and analyzing financial and operational data, conducting ad-hoc research, preparing and coordinating confidential documents, and ensuring the senior leaders are wellprepared for meetings, presentations, and key decisions. Acting as a trusted partner, the Finance Coordinator exercises sound judgment, professionalism, and discretion while liaising with internal and external stakeholders. The ideal candidate thrives in a fastpaced environment, demonstrates strong attention to detail, and is adept at balancing competing priorities while maintaining the highest level of confidentiality and efficiency. The expected hiring salary range for this position is CAD $72,600 $88,800. The actual base salary offered is determined based on the successful candidates relevant experience, skills and competencies and will consider internal equity. Position Responsibilities Finance function support and direct administrative support to SVP, Finance & CFO and VP, Corporate Finance: Compile and validate financial and operational data and assist with the analysis of key financial metrics and KPIs. Assist with the creation of visually engaging presentations of financial data and the development of highquality communication materials for leadership audiences. Conduct adhoc research using internal and external data and information sources, including market data, and synthesize into organized data sets and concise briefing notes. Ensure CFO is well prepared in advance of Board, Audit Committee, ELT, GLC, GFF, Leadership Team meetings and Investor trips. Organize materials and manage action items. Compilation and reproduction of Audit, Risk & Finance Committee meeting materials in an accurate manner and distribute to members within the specified deadline. Assist with CFOs time management, ensuring calendar, email, contacts and filing is kept up to date. Exercise judgement in responding to general inquiries while preserving confidentiality at all times. Arrange accurate, cost effective and timely travel arrangements. Ensure effective communication channels are in place between CFO and internal teams and individuals. Arrange and attend Finance Leadership Team meetings. Proactive in trying to improve processes in everyday workflow, maintain delegate access to vacation and timeoff requests and complete monthly visa expenses. Maintain Delegation of Authority for Vancouver departments, securing appropriate signatures and ensuring all appropriate people receive in a timely manner and file is kept up to date for Audit purposes. Proactively monitor when organizational changes occur. Support to: VP, Business Transformation Assist with the development of presentations, memos, and other communication materials for a range of audiences including ELT and Board. Conduct adhoc research on industry trends and peer company practices and adhoc analysis on business performance. Maintain a central repository of business performance information and project plans; work crossfunctionally to ensure information is continually uptodate. Work with the VP to facilitate regular business performance processes, working cross functionally, so that we are able to track progress, measure performance and work closely with Finance to measure value realization through earnings and cash flow. Setup meetings including booking rooms, equipment, catering and preparation of meeting materials. Arrange accurate, cost effective and timely travel arrangements. Other miscellaneous adhoc administrative duties including expense reporting and invoice payments. Supporting Global Finance Forum (GFF) Organize and attend quarterly GFF meetings. Set up meetings (phone, inperson, Videoconferencing), book meeting rooms & organize catering. Coordinate & prepare agendas. Gather prereading documents and presentations and issue in advance of meetings. Provide support in producing and maintaining the GFF business plan and meeting action items. Maintain and update the GFF Sharepoint page. For offsite meetings, identify and decide on hotels, meeting space, dinner venues and team building. Coordinate travel logistics and visas. Work with regional admin to coordinate when meeting is held in one of the regional sites. Position Qualifications 3+ years experience in a similar role, ideally in a Finance environment. Working knowledge of the financial and investment markets, comfortable with financial terminology, reports, budgets, and spreadsheets. Highly organized and thoughtful with analytical and quantitative problemsolving skills. Excellent verbal and written communication skills to create executive level materials with high attention to detail.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Excel, PowerPoint, Word, Teams).Skilled in managing complex calendars, travel arrangements, and scheduling across time zones. Strong interpersonal skills and ability to build relationships. Demonstrated ability to work with senior leaders and crossfunctional teams. Proven ability to work under pressure, handle confidential information with discretion, be adaptable to various competing demands, and demonstrate the highest level of customer/client service and response.
